KARL J. WARREN CANANDAIGUA, NY - Karl J. Warren, age 82, formerly of Ithaca, died Sunday, June 15, 2008 at MM Ewing Continuing Care Center in Canandaigua. He is survived by his wife of 30 years, Mary Warren; 5 children, Karl (Janice) Warren Jr. of Rome, NY, Stuart C. (Sandra) Warren of Florida,...
